Application #4: Serial-over-Secure-TCP Tunnel

MULTINET4 MULTI-PORT SERIAL SERVER & MANAGED SWITCH – INSTRUCTION MANUAL
Two Multinet4 devices are used to connect two serial devices over a TCP/IP network. This
example is like Application #2 except that all of the serial data passing over the network is
encrypted. In addition, the initial connection includes an SSL handshake that forces each
side to authenticate using RSA keys and X.509 certificates. This setup not only prevents
intruders from snooping on active serial sessions but it also prevents them from
connecting to an open terminal server port and impersonating a host.
FIGURE 7–11: Serial-over-Secure-TCP Tunnel
Both sides of the terminal server connection must be configured for SSL.
SSL is configured on the Multinet4 for serial port S1 as shown in the figure below:
